Output 72887828075c770507c30b1368689f8791e94a42d38e570fa1ec734520204080:1

value
7857219
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b1ae611d586e8958c78ac536d99564223abee227 OP_EQUALVERIFY OP_CHECKSIG
address
1HCVW3YidDfpSfi4PzZKvN3zBoLpAnbKRt
transaction
72887828075c770507c30b1368689f8791e94a42d38e570fa1ec734520204080
spent
true